While people across Australia are counting and submitting surveys of birds in their own home patch, we are heading back out to Lake Cowal to see what birds we can find and put on the map. So bring your binoculars and help us submit our survey!
The BirdLife Australia Aussie Bird Count runs from 19-25 October, 2026. You can submit your own surveys of birds in own backyard, park or nature reserve through out this week. We recommend downloading the Aussie Bird Count app to submit your surveys and use year round as a bird guide.
